Output 98591ba6ef46217fd236d352fc20c98b221f28218adf44a29ba4c82058214190:1

value
17362570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e479391a29af8a4a4c04b8b30de9a23e0d1e6c OP_EQUAL
address
M8ctfPgvuC9zbRKzL7bFvx5y98SkuFxKcQ
transaction
98591ba6ef46217fd236d352fc20c98b221f28218adf44a29ba4c82058214190
spent
true